1972 Fiat 128 vs. 2008 Pontiac G6
To start off, 2008 Pontiac G6 is newer by 36 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1972 Fiat 128.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1972 Fiat 128 would be higher. At 3,600 cc (6 cylinders), 2008 Pontiac G6 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Pontiac G6 (252 HP @ 6300 RPM) has 189 more horse power than 1972 Fiat 128. (63 HP @ 6000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2008 Pontiac G6 should accelerate faster than 1972 Fiat 128.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Pontiac G6 weights approximately 532 kg more than 1972 Fiat 128.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2008 Pontiac G6 (340 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 257 more torque (in Nm) than 1972 Fiat 128. (83 Nm @ 4400 RPM). This means 2008 Pontiac G6 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1972 Fiat 128.
Compare all specifications:
1972 Fiat 128 | 2008 Pontiac G6 | |
Make | Fiat | Pontiac |
Model | 128 | G6 |
Year Released | 1972 | 2008 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1115 cc | 3600 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 63 HP | 252 HP |
Engine RPM | 6000 RPM | 6300 RPM |
Torque | 83 Nm | 340 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4400 RPM | 3200 RPM |
Number of Seats | 4 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 820 kg | 1352 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3820 mm | 4810 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1570 mm | 1800 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1320 mm | 1460 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2240 mm | 2860 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 50 L | 62 L |
